  • Patent number: 11787430
    Abstract: An apparatus for processing an accelerator pedal mis-operation of a driver: includes a vehicle information obtaining device that obtains vehicle information corresponding to an operation of the driver; and a processor that detects an accelerator pedal monitoring situation based on the vehicle information and determine the accelerator pedal mis-operation of the driver based on an opening degree of an accelerator pedal corresponding to the operation of the driver in the accelerator pedal monitoring situation to switch a vehicle mode to enter a safe mode.

  • Patent number: 11472302
    Abstract: The charging inlet assembly may include: a charging inlet provided at a predetermined position of the vehicle; a charging connector detachably coupled to the charging inlet; a supporting plate covering at least a rear surface of the charging inlet; a supporting rod extending from the supporting plate toward the charging inlet and configured to be coupled to the charging inlet; and at least one elastic member elastically connecting the charging inlet and the supporting plate.

  • Publication number: 20210323434
    Abstract: A wireless power transfer apparatus may include a charging controller configured of generating a current instruction and a voltage instruction for wireless power transfer, a first circuit portion connected to the charging controller and an external power source and configured of converting an electric power supplied from the external power source to corresponding voltage value and corresponding current value according to the voltage instruction and the current instruction, and a primary coil connected to the first circuit portion and configured of generating an induced current in a secondary coil of an electric vehicle to deliver the electric power converted by the first circuit portion to the electric vehicle, wherein the charging controller estimates temperature of the secondary coil by use of the current value applied to the primary coil, and changes the current instruction for determining a current value applied to the primary coil, according to the estimated temperature of the secondary coil.
